Your free Global ESG compliance checklist
One of the most important topics affecting all businesses, globally, is Environmental, Social and Governance (ESG) compliance. Regulators, investors and society at large all increasingly expect businesses to address and report on ESG matters. How well your business handles ESG today, will determine how successful and sustainable it is tomorrow.
Your Complimentary Checklist
This complimentary checklist can help you...